105,247,496,395,811 is an odd composite number composed of four pr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 105247496395811 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 4 prime factors (large circles) and 16 divisors.

105247496395811 is an odd compos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of sixteen divisors.

Prime factorization of 105247496395811:

7 × 11 × 19 × 71939505397
